In trigonometry, the gradian, also known as the gon (from Ancient Greek: γωνία, romanized: gōnía, lit. 'angle'), grad, or grade, is a unit of measurement of an angle, defined as one hundredth of the right angle; in other words, there are 100 gradians in 90 degrees. WebDec 1, 2024 · Angle Units: the type and deg, grad, rad, turn units. Angle values are s denoted by . The angle unit identifiers are: deg Degrees. There are 360 degrees in a full circle. grad Gradians, also known as "gons" or "grades". There are 400 gradians in a full circle. rad Radians. There are 2π radians in a full circle. turn ...
